Why You Should Watch the ATP Buenos Aires Tournament

The ATP Buenos Aires tournament, officially known as the Argentina Open, is a prestigious clay-court event on the ATP Tour. It attracts some of the top players in the world, making for some thrilling matches. This tournament is not only a fantastic display of skill and strategy, but it also has a rich history and a vibrant atmosphere that makes it a must-watch for any tennis enthusiast. From nail-biting finishes to stunning upsets, the Buenos Aires Open consistently delivers unforgettable moments.

The allure of the Argentina Open extends beyond the competition itself. Buenos Aires, with its passionate tennis fans and lively culture, provides a unique backdrop for the tournament. The clay courts of the Buenos Aires Lawn Tennis Club have witnessed countless memorable battles, and the energy of the crowd adds an extra layer of excitement. Plus, the tournament often serves as a key warm-up for other major clay-court events, meaning players are in top form and eager to make a statement.

Official Streaming Options for ATP Buenos Aires

When it comes to watching ATP Buenos Aires live, the official streaming options are your best bet for a high-quality, reliable viewing experience. These platforms typically offer comprehensive coverage, including multiple camera angles, expert commentary, and real-time stats. By choosing official sources, you're not only ensuring a smooth viewing experience but also supporting the sport and its organizers.

One of the primary official streaming options is the Tennis TV platform. Tennis TV is the ATP's official streaming service, and it provides extensive coverage of ATP Tour events throughout the year. With a subscription, you can access live streams of matches, replays, highlights, and a wealth of on-demand content. Tennis TV is an excellent choice for serious tennis fans who want to follow the ATP Tour closely, offering a dedicated platform with a user-friendly interface and high-definition streams.

Another key player in broadcasting the ATP Buenos Aires tournament is ESPN. ESPN often holds the broadcast rights for major tennis events, including those on the ATP Tour. Check your local ESPN listings or the ESPN+ streaming service to see if they are showing the Buenos Aires Open. ESPN+ offers a wide range of live sports content, making it a valuable option for sports enthusiasts. Subscribing to ESPN+ can give you access to not only tennis but also a variety of other sports, providing a comprehensive sports streaming solution.

TSN is a prominent sports network in Canada that frequently broadcasts ATP Tour events. If you're in Canada, check TSN's schedule to see if they are airing the ATP Buenos Aires tournament. TSN offers a mix of live coverage and on-demand content, making it a great option for Canadian tennis fans. By tuning into TSN, you can enjoy live matches, expert analysis, and all the excitement of the Argentina Open.

Using a VPN to Watch ATP Buenos Aires Live

If you find that certain streaming services are not available in your region, using a Virtual Private Network (VPN) can be a game-changer. A VPN allows you to change your IP address, making it appear as if you are accessing the internet from a different location. This can be particularly useful for accessing streaming services that have geographic restrictions. By using a VPN, you can bypass these restrictions and watch the ATP Buenos Aires tournament live, no matter where you are in the world.

To use a VPN effectively, you'll need to choose a reputable VPN provider. There are many VPN services available, each with its own set of features and pricing plans. Some popular VPN providers include NordVPN, ExpressVPN, and Surfshark. These services offer fast and reliable connections, as well as strong security features to protect your online privacy. When selecting a VPN, consider factors such as server locations, speed, security, and ease of use to find the best fit for your needs.

Once you've chosen a VPN provider, the next step is to download and install the VPN software on your device. Most VPN providers offer apps for various platforms, including Windows, macOS, iOS, and Android. After installing the VPN, you'll need to connect to a server in a region where the streaming service you want to access is available. For example, if a streaming service is only available in the US, you would connect to a US-based server.

After connecting to the VPN server, you can then access the streaming service as if you were located in that region. This allows you to bypass geographic restrictions and watch the ATP Buenos Aires tournament live. Keep in mind that some streaming services may have measures in place to detect VPN usage, so it's always a good idea to test your VPN connection before the tournament begins to ensure everything is working smoothly.

Tips for the Best Live Streaming Experience

To ensure you have the best possible experience watching ATP Buenos Aires live, there are a few key tips to keep in mind. These tips cover everything from ensuring a stable internet connection to choosing the right streaming device, helping you avoid common pitfalls and enjoy uninterrupted coverage of the tournament.

First and foremost, a stable internet connection is crucial for smooth streaming. Nothing is more frustrating than buffering or lag during a crucial match point. Ensure you have a strong Wi-Fi signal or, even better, a wired Ethernet connection for the most reliable performance. If you're using Wi-Fi, try to minimize the number of devices using the network simultaneously, as this can impact your streaming quality. Testing your internet speed beforehand can also give you an idea of whether you'll be able to stream in high definition without issues.

Choosing the right streaming device can also make a big difference. While you can watch on your computer, tablet, or smartphone, a larger screen like a smart TV or a monitor can enhance the viewing experience. Many smart TVs come with built-in streaming apps, making it easy to access services like Tennis TV or ESPN+. Alternatively, you can use streaming devices like Roku, Amazon Fire Stick, or Apple TV to stream content to your TV. These devices offer a user-friendly interface and often support high-definition streaming, providing a more immersive viewing experience.

Make sure your streaming apps are up to date. Streaming services frequently release updates to improve performance and fix bugs. By keeping your apps updated, you can ensure you're getting the best possible streaming quality and taking advantage of the latest features. Many devices and platforms offer automatic updates, but it's always a good idea to double-check before the tournament begins.
